Common Water Heater Problems We Fix
We repair gas and electric tank water heaters and service tankless systems. The symptoms below often point to a component failure, sediment buildup, or tank damage that requires professional diagnosis.
Signs of Water Heater Trouble
You might notice there’s no hot water at all, or that it runs out much faster than it used to. Sometimes the water is only lukewarm, or it turns rusty or discolored when you turn the tap. Other times you might hear popping or banging sounds from the tank, or see water pooling around the base in your basement or utility room.
These symptoms can come from several sources. Electric water heaters may have failed heating elements, thermostat problems, or power-supply issues. Gas water heaters can develop problems with the pilot light, burner, gas supply, or venting. Sediment buildup from minerals in the water often collects at the bottom of a tank water heater, making the system work harder and leading to noise, reduced efficiency, or overheating over time.
Leaks may result from worn gaskets, loose connections, or corrosion in the tank itself. If a tank is leaking from a rusted area, replacement is usually more practical than repair because the metal has already weakened. If the issue is with a valve, fitting, temperature and pressure relief valve, or another control component, a focused repair may restore normal operation without replacing the entire unit.
Safety is always part of the conversation with water heaters. Gas appliances must have proper venting and combustion air, and electrical connections need to be correctly sized and protected. Our plumbers evaluate these conditions and shut systems down safely when needed. We explain what’s happening and what your options are before you decide how to move forward.
